When to start simple puzzles with babies?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Keith Ramsey answered

Specializes in Pediatrics - Adolescent Medicine

Varies: I don't think there is an exact answer. The child would need to be able to manipulate the pieces. I think by 18 months, most children could do some easy shapes with help. Younger children might be able to do them and then some 2 year olds might have frustration with them. So try them and if they are too frustrating, then wait about 6 months and try again.
